5 miles in 47 minutes. Precor Treadmill set at 1% Grade, all at 6.4 mph (Pace 9:22 miles) Average heartrate: 151 bpm. Cardiac Drift: 158 bpm. Shoes: Nike Air Structure, 454 miles. Need to find replacement shoes soon. Left ankle is a tad sore, but nothing serious. Heart rate a little higher than I wish, no doubt not fully recovered from the marathon.
I'm following the postmarathon recovery schedule that's from "Advanced Marathoning" by Pete Pfitzinger and Scott Douglas. Last week's recovery miles were only 16 miles total, which was Wednesday 4 miles, Friday 5 miles, and Sunday 7 miles. This week training will eventually be a total of 30 miles.
